    Stock NA DOHC 4g63:
    135hp
    125ftlbs

    Stock NA SOHC 4g64:
    141hp
    148ftlbs

    Stock NA DOHC 4g64:
    160hp
    160ftlbs

    Headswap should take you up to a stock GS performance level. 2.4L DOHC > 2.0L DOHC.

    The only real difference( besides displacement) would be that you have more parts available to build up the bottom end on the 63, but you could custom order pistons or rods for the 64 and then you would have just as strong of an engine with more torque down low and in my opinion that would be well worth the extra cost to have anything custom machined. But hey to each their own and good luck either way.
